Herpes simplex virus type 2 (HSV-2) antigens ICP4 and glycoprotein D (gD2) are the primary components of the therapeutic vaccine candidate GEN-003, designed to treat genital herpes (Wald et al., 2016, JCI Insight). ICP4 (Infected Cell Protein 4) is a large, essential immediate-early protein that functions as a transcriptional activator for early and late viral genes, making it a critical target for T-cell mediated immunity (Skoberne et al., 2013, Vaccine). Glycoprotein D (gD2) is an envelope protein essential for viral entry into host cells via interaction with receptors like HVEM and nectin-1, and it is the primary target for neutralizing antibodies (Bernstein et al., 2014, Vaccine). The specific constructs used in immunotherapy include ICP4.2, a recombinant fragment of the ICP4 protein, and gD2ΔTMR, a truncated version of glycoprotein D lacking the transmembrane region to improve solubility and secretion. These antigens are formulated with adjuvants to induce both polyfunctional CD4+ T-cell responses and high titers of neutralizing antibodies. The therapeutic goal of targeting these antigens is to enhance the host's ability to suppress viral reactivation from latency in the sacral ganglia, thereby reducing clinical lesion frequency and subclinical viral shedding (Van Wagoner et al., 2018, PLOS ONE). Clinical trials have demonstrated that immunization with these antigens can lead to a significant reduction in the rate of viral shedding and the number of days with genital lesions. While GEN-003 development was discontinued by Genocea, these antigens remain significant targets in the field of HSV-2 immunotherapy research.
Induction of antigen-specific T-cell and B-cell immune responses to suppress viral reactivation and entry.
